Tout d'abord. Avec cette petite et simple commande tar, nous archivons toutes nos données /var/www/.
tar -zcvf archive.tar.gz /var/wwwCode language: JavaScript (javascript) Maintenant, nous vidons la base de données MySQL avec la commande suivante.
mysqldump -u root -p databasename > /root/backupname.sqlCode language: JavaScript (javascript) Il vous sera demandé d'écrire le mot de passe de l'utilisateur de la base de données (dans ce cas racine).
scp archive.tar.gz root@destinationserver:/root
scp /root/backupname.sql root@destinationserver:/root
Encore une fois, il vous sera demandé deux fois le mot de passe du serveur distant mais toutes vos données sensibles y seront enregistrées.
Encore une fois, c'est une démonstration très simple et juste une petite démonstration de ce que vous pouvez faire avec tar, scp et ssh.